Transaction 8e50cb08e162d8f659f78b8b0305270bc5ad26e36a97bd4851b43629ec1d91ea
1 Input
1 Output
-
8e50cb08e162d8f659f78b8b0305270bc5ad26e36a97bd4851b43629ec1d91ea:0
- value
- 2694679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c44f3cf9c9211fb870fbabd0e7e492821a378ab7 OP_EQUAL
- address
- 3Kb1Hi2jSqsTm7dUh8JWVXgf3p88zQiZ7y